ESTA application
Spanish citizens who wish to visit the United States for business or pleasure need to apply for ESTA before they board an air or sea vessel. The application should be completed at least 72 hours before you plan to depart. You must have a valid Spanish passport that is valid on the date you plan to arrive in the US. You must also have a valid email address to receive an approved ESTA.

DS-160 application
Before filling out the DS-160 application, make sure you have a passport and a valid U.S. address. The application can be completed in 30 minutes to an hour online. It will require you to answer several questions honestly, in English. Make sure to follow the directions carefully.
A recent photo should be included. The photograph should be in a size that complies with the government’s guidelines. Using a digital photo will save you time during the interview process. Ensure that your image meets all of the US visa’s image requirements.
If you are a temporary worker, you will need to provide information about your future employer. Your DS-160 form must be complete and accurate. If you do not complete it correctly, you will have to start again.
